一、全球化容器部署的安全痛点分析
海外云服务器的Windows容器镜像仓库部署面临独特安全挑战。跨国数据传输需遵守GDPR等国际数据保护法规,而传统密码验证机制存在撞库攻击风险。以东南亚某金融科技公司案例说明,其部署在AWS法兰克福节点的容器仓库因单一认证漏洞,导致7万条镜像数据泄露。这种情形下,多因素认证(Multi-Factor Authentication)通过生物识别、硬件密钥等维度组合验证,可将未经授权访问风险降低92%。企业需重点评估云服务商地域合规性,微软Azure在欧洲数据中心提供的FIPS 140-2认证加密服务。
二、Windows容器环境MFA技术适配方案
针对Windows容器镜像仓库的架构特性,实施多因素认证需解决容器临时身份的生命周期管理问题。通过Azure Active Directory(AAD)与Kubernetes RBAC权限控制集成,可建立动态访问令牌机制。具体实现路径包括:1)使用YubiKey等物理安全密钥进行SSH连接验证;2)配置基于时间的一次性密码(TOTP)与Windows容器运行时环境集成;3)部署智能地理位置分析模块,自动拦截异常区域访问请求。测试数据显示,该方案使新加坡某游戏公司的镜像推送操作授权时间缩短至1.3秒,同时非法访问尝试拦截率达98.7%。
三、混合云环境下的认证协议兼容处理
跨云平台部署时,OpenID Connect与SAML协议的转换成为关键。建议采用SPNEGO协商协议构建统一认证层,实现AWS IAM角色与本地AD域控的双向信任。技术实现需特别注意Kerberos票据在容器间的安全传递,可通过加密的Kubernetes Secrets存储票据副本。在Google Cloud东京区域的实测案例中,该方法成功实现跨AWS、Azure、本地数据中心的镜像同步认证,平均认证延迟控制在200ms内,较传统方案提升60%效能。
四、镜像签名与MFA的协同验证机制
Notary v2签名框架与多因素认证的结合强化了供应链安全。在镜像推送阶段,强制要求开发者同时提交符合X.509标准的代码签名证书和物理MFA设备认证。微软Azure Container Registry的最新实践显示,该机制可自动验证镜像哈希值与签名时间戳,当检测到伦敦与悉尼节点间的镜像哈希差异时,会触发二次生物特征验证流程。某汽车制造企业采用该方案后,将镜像篡改事件归零,CI/CD流水线错误率下降79%。
五、生产环境下的实施风险控制策略
为避免MFA引入的操作复杂性影响容器编排效率,建议实施分级认证策略。开发测试环境采用TOTP+短信验证的轻量级组合,而生产环境则强制执行FIDO2认证标准。关键操作如跨区域镜像复制,需通过至少三个独立验证因素。根据GCP安全团队公布的基准测试,这种弹性认证架构使得阿姆斯特丹节点的容器启动时间仅增加0.8秒,同时将横向渗透攻击的防御能力提升至L4安全等级。
六、持续安全监控与审计追踪建设
建立全景式的认证日志分析体系是维持安全态势的关键。通过将Auth
0、Okta等IDaaS平台的日志流与Splunk集成,可实现认证异常的实时检测。某欧洲医疗云案例中,系统通过机器学习识别出巴西利亚节点的异常凌晨访问模式,自动触发MFA复核并阻断勒索软件攻击。审计方面,必须完整记录每次镜像操作的MFA验证证据链,包括设备指纹、地理位置和生物特征样本哈希值,以满足ISO 27001的审计要求。